    Biography

    Dr. Baumgarten specializes in genitourinary reconstruction, urologic trauma, and prosthetic urology. He joined UAB Urology after completing residency training at the University of South Florida followed by a fellowship in urologic trauma, reconstruction, and prosthetics at the University of Texas Southwestern Medical Center. He underwent advanced training in the treatment of urethral stricture disease, erectile dysfunction, male stress urinary incontinence, Peyronie’s disease, ureteral stricture disease, genitourinary trauma, and genitourinary fistulas.

    Dr. Baumgarten specializes in complex urethroplasty surgery, penile prosthesis placement, artificial urinary sphincter and male trans obturator sling placement, and both robotic and open urinary tract reconstruction.

    Dr. Baumgarten serves as the Director of Medical Student Education for the Department of Urology, as well as the Assistant Program Director of the Urology Residency Program. He is committed to fostering and training our next generation of urologic surgeons. He also serves as the Ambulatory Quality Officer for the Urology, Orthopedic Surgery, and Otolaryngology departments.
